1//! OneDrive `CloudHome` implementation.
2//!
3//! Uses the Microsoft Graph API. Files are stored flat in a single folder — path
4//! separators are escaped by the `key_encoding` helpers. The
5//! `read`/`read_range`/`list`/`delete` methods are the shared `OAuthRestHome`
6//! implementations; this file supplies only the Graph request shapes, the page
7//! parser, the upload paths, and sharing.

468/// `error.code` from a Microsoft Graph error body (e.g. `"quotaLimitReached"`),
469/// or `None` if the body isn't Graph JSON.
470fn parse_onedrive_error_code(body: &str) -> Option<String> {
471    http::error_reason(body, |v| {
472        v.get("error")?.get("code")?.as_str().map(String::from)
473    })
474}
475
476/// Map a OneDrive write failure to a `CloudHomeError`. The `quotaLimitReached`
477/// code gets a message naming the provider and the recovery step; everything else
478/// keeps the raw HTTP status + body for debugging.
479fn classify_write_error(status: reqwest::StatusCode, body: &str, key: &str) -> CloudHomeError {
480    let code = parse_onedrive_error_code(body);
481    if code.as_deref() == Some("nameAlreadyExists") {
482        return CloudHomeError::AlreadyExists(key.to_string());
483    }
484    if code.as_deref() == Some("quotaLimitReached") {
485        return CloudHomeError::Transport(
486            "Your OneDrive storage is full. Free up space at onedrive.live.com to keep syncing."
487                .to_string(),
488        );
489    }
490    CloudHomeError::Transport(format!("write {key} (HTTP {status}): {body}"))
491}
492
493/// Files at or below this size go up as a single PUT; larger files use a resumable
494/// session. Microsoft Graph caps a simple PUT at 250 MiB.
495const ONEDRIVE_SIMPLE_PUT_MAX: usize = 4 * 1024 * 1024;
496
497/// Resumable-session part size. Graph requires every part except the last to be a
498/// multiple of 320 KiB; 7.5 MiB (24 × 320 KiB) keeps the request count low.
499const ONEDRIVE_CHUNK_SIZE: usize = 24 * 320 * 1024;
